
Paperback
Published 21 Jan 2014
66 results
Paperback
Published 21 Jan 2014
Paperback
Published 23 Jun 2015
Paperback
Published 11 Aug 2015
Paperback
Published 19 Feb 2019
Book
Published 01 Jan 2008
Book
Published 01 Jan 2012